Bought my 1992 (J REG) RED FD3S ifini Type R in december 2010, but starting to think i may not have the money to keep it (fuel is pretty expensive!)
 
Ive fixed most the little things that were wrong (broken fuel flap & broken drivers door handle), and carried out all the maintenance tasks as recommended on here ready for a summer of rotary fun.
 
Oil Filter change
Powder coated aluminium door handles
Power steering and aircon belts replaced
Fuel filter & spark plugs still to be done but will be done next week.
Fitted MPH converter / delimiter.
Fusion Ipod-CD player to be fitted next week.
 
The car is fully standard and every single bit of it works if you get what i mean (pop up lights, windows, mirrors, power aerial ect, ect), runs well too. Bit of white smoke on start up (when cold outside) then soon clears to nothing, so normal behaviour as i can tell, doesnt drink any water, and oil doesnt move much either.
 
Interior plastics are a bit scratched up (common on early examples) and the bodywork does need a little tlc to be perfect ( few small scrapes, and little dings / small spots of laquer peel).
 
engine was rebuilt at 50k miles in 2000, and has now done approximately 75k miles.
 
Car cost me £4200 to buy, is completely standard, and ive spent roughly 3 - 400 quid on servicing bits tidying it up etc.
 
Theres plenty of history in a folder, from import in 1997, the 1 owner from 1997 to december 2010 when i bought the car. Between 1997 - 2010, theres approximately 12 full service receipts from mazda main dealer if this means much to people, and plenty other receipts
 
How much would you think it would be worth in private sale?
